Programme Overview

The Undergraduate Certificate in Implementing Quantum Key Distribution Systems is a specialised programme designed for students and professionals seeking to acquire expertise in the development and deployment of secure communication systems. This programme covers the fundamental principles of quantum mechanics, quantum computing, and cryptography, as well as the practical aspects of designing and implementing Quantum Key Distribution (QKD) systems.

Through a combination of theoretical and hands-on training, learners will develop a deep understanding of QKD protocols, such as BB84 and Ekert91, and acquire practical skills in programming languages like Q# and Qiskit. They will also learn to design and implement secure communication networks using QKD systems, and develop expertise in security analysis and risk assessment. The programme's curriculum is tailored to provide learners with a comprehensive understanding of the technical and practical aspects of QKD systems.
